What is MartGeo?
MartGeo shows you which nearby shops have the product, property or service you need. Search on a map, see which shops in your area have it and how far away they are, then contact the shop directly by phone or WhatsApp. MartGeo is not a shop itself — there is no cart, no delivery and no commission. You deal directly with the shopkeeper.
Which areas does MartGeo cover?
MartGeo currently covers B-17 (Multi Gardens) in Islamabad and Faisal Hills in Taxila. We add one society at a time as local shops, dealers and kaarigars join, so coverage grows steadily rather than thinly across the whole country.
What can I find on MartGeo?
Three things: products from local shops (mobile phones and accessories, electronics, opticals, perfumes and general retail), property listed by local dealer offices (plots and houses for sale and rent, with plot number, block, size and demand), and kaarigars — masons, auto mechanics, solar and UPS technicians, tailors, AC and fridge technicians, welders, carpenters, plumbers, electricians and more.
Can I order or pay through MartGeo?
No. MartGeo has no cart, no online payment and no delivery. It shows you who has what nearby; the purchase happens the way it always has — directly with the shopkeeper, at the shop or over WhatsApp.
Is MartGeo free for buyers?
Yes, completely free. You do not even need an account: open the site in any browser, set your location and search. There is no app to download.
Why do some listings not show a price?
Many shopkeepers prefer to quote their price directly rather than publish it. Those listings show "Available — contact shop", and you agree the price with the seller on WhatsApp or by phone. Where a shop has listed a price, you will see it.
How do I contact a shop or kaarigar?
Every listing has Call and WhatsApp buttons that reach the shop's own number directly. There is no in-app chat and no middleman — you talk to the shopkeeper or kaarigar yourself.

How do I list my shop on MartGeo?
Sign up as a seller, add your shop and its location on the map, then list your products from your phone in a few minutes. Listing is free and there is no commission on anything you sell.
I am a property dealer. How do I add my inventory?
Paste the inventory messages you already send in WhatsApp groups. MartGeo reads the usual shorthand — society, block, plot number, size and demand — and turns it into structured listings automatically. Your daily routine does not change.
I am a kaarigar. How do buyers find me?
Your listing appears under your trade for your area, so someone searching for an electrician, mason or AC technician nearby sees you with your own phone number. Buyers call or WhatsApp you directly.
Does MartGeo take a commission or handle my payments?
No. MartGeo never touches the transaction — there is no payment rail, no delivery and no cut of your sale. Customers contact you directly and you deal with them yourself, exactly as you do today.
Do I have to publish my prices?
No. Price is optional. If you leave it out, your listing shows "Available — contact shop" and customers contact you for the price.
